Just did my cabin filter on a '14 Explorer. If you try to NOT take the white pins out, unless you have tiny little arms and hands, you'll ultimately force the glove box door down far enough to crack the plastic on the door that forms a circle around the white pin. No fanfare, it just splits open. I applaud the OP on this video because he stuck with putting the pins back in all the way to the bitter end. Also, the tip about how the slot in the white pin lines plays a crucial role. All the other videos I watched, the guys just put the cover back over the cabin filter and magically its all assembled in the last shots. One trick I found was using a mirror and flashlight so I could actually see what I was doing. The second trick was getting the white pin through the first hole in the dash and through the hole in the door. If you're doing this with the door latched it won't be lined up and will NOT go through to the last hole in the dash. The key was to unlatch the door and begin slowly opening it until you see the pin lined up with the last hole then driving the white pin on home. I have broken the code on how to get those little white pins back in. Before you start to put the door back on, place each pin into their channel, until the are "in the groove". Have a piece of scotch tape handy, and push the pin back out, until it just clears the hinge gap, and then tape it in place. After both side are taped securely, you can re-install the door, and then carefully reach under, and slide the pins in place. Usually the tape will release as you push it in, but even if some of it stays, it won't interfere with the operation of the door.
